Understanding Fascia and Soffit
What is Fascia?
Fascia refers to the horizontal boards that run along the edge of a roof, placed simply below the roofline. Normally, it serves numerous functions:
- Protection: Fascia boards protect the interior structure of the roof from wetness and bugs by serving as a barrier versus weather condition components.
- Visual Appeal: It offers a completed want to the roofline, improving the overall look of the structure.
- Structural Support: These boards hold the lower edge of the roofing system and support the gutters, contributing to water drainage.
What is Soffit?
Soffit, on the other hand, is the product that bridges the area in between the top of the outside wall and the bottom of the roofing system overhang. Its functions consist of:
- Ventilation: Soffit plays a critical role in promoting air flow into the attic, preventing wetness accumulation and minimizing the threat of mold growth.
- Protection: It safeguards rafters from the elements, thereby prolonging their lifespan.
- Visual Coherence: Soffits can add an ornamental component to the eaves, contributing to a home’s curb appeal.
Typical Types of Fascia and Soffit Materials
Material | Fascia | Soffit |
---|---|---|
Wood | Conventional and aesthetically attractive however vulnerable to rot and warping if not regularly preserved. | Provides a warm look but needs regular upkeep. |
Vinyl | Long lasting and low-maintenance; offered in various colors. | Low maintenance and resistant to rot but can fade. |
Aluminum | Light-weight, rust-proof, and offered in many colors; can dent easily. | Uses good ventilation choices and resilience. |
Composite | Made from crafted materials, making sure resistance to weather and pests. | Versatile and effective in ventilation and visual appeals. |

Frequently asked questions
How often should fascia and soffit be inspected?
Fascia and soffit ought to be inspected at least as soon as a year, preferably before and after seasonal changes. This ensures that any possible damage can be dealt with swiftly.
Can I paint my fascia and soffit?
Yes, both wood and some composite materials can be painted. However, make sure to utilize suitable, premium outside paint to protect versus weather components.
How do I understand if I require to replace my fascia or soffit?
Signs that replacement might be needed consist of visible rot or decay, drooping, peeling paint, or insect invasions. If in doubt, speak with a professional.
What is the typical cost of fascia and soffit installation?
The cost can vary greatly depending on products, labor, and the area of installation. Normally, homeowners can expect to pay between ₤ 1,500 and ₤ 3,000 for a full installation, however getting quotes from experts is recommended for accurate figures.
How can I maintain my fascia and soffit?
- Routine Cleaning: Remove debris, such as leaves and dirt, to avoid obstructions and structural damage.
- Seal Gaps: Ensure that any gaps are sealed to prevent moisture and insect entry.
- Paint Maintenance: For wooden fascia, keep an eye on paint wear and reapply as required for defense.
